Galaxy F62 has a general score of 88.1, which is much better than Honor 50's global score of 74.5. Both phones in this comparison include the same Android 11 OS (operating system). The Galaxy F62 body is thicker and heavier than the Honor 50. Honor 50 features a little better hardware performance than Galaxy F62, because it has a greater number of cores and a greater amount of RAM.
The Galaxy F62 features a slightly better screen than Honor 50, because it has a quite better 1080 x 2400px resolution, a little bigger display and a little bit better pixel density. Honor 50 captures a little bit better photos and videos than Galaxy F62, because although it has a tinier aperture which is not favorable for low light photography and video, and they both have the same 30 frames per second video frame rate and the same (4K) video quality, the Honor 50 also counts with a lot higher resolution back-facing camera.
The Galaxy F62 counts with a much bigger memory to install games and applications than Honor 50, and although they both have exactly the same 128 GB internal storage, the Galaxy F62 also has a SD extension slot that holds up to 1 TB. Galaxy F62 features a very superior battery life than Honor 50, because it has a 7000mAh battery capacity.
